The Connection Between Coffee Beans and Coffee Makers

The relationship between coffee beans and coffee makers is critical. Different types of coffee beans, such as Arabica and Robusta, offer unique flavor profiles, which can be accentuated or diminished based on the brewing method.

In assessing various coffee makers, it is important to consider their compatibility with the specific beans chosen.

"The right brewing method can elevate the simplest beans, transforming them into an exceptional cup of coffee."

Consider how certain machines, like espresso makers or French presses, operate differently, requiring specific coarseness of grind or brewing time. Understanding these intricacies is essential for those who wish to master their coffee-making skills.

Why Coffee Beans Matter

Selecting the right coffee bean does not only impact flavor; it serves as the foundation for a satisfying coffee experience. Factors influencing selection include:

  • Origin: Coffee beans come from diverse regions, each contributing unique characteristics. For example, beans from Colombia are often known for their smooth sweetness, while beans from Ethiopia are appreciated for their fruity notes.
  • Processing method: How beans are processed post-harvest can dramatically affect taste. Options include washed, natural, and honey processing.
  • Roast level: The degree of roasting influences acidity and flavor depth. Light roasts retain more acidity and fruity notes, while dark roasts tend to be bolder and less acidic.

Understanding these factors fosters a more informed decision when choosing coffee beans, enhancing overall enjoyment.

Choosing the Right Coffee Maker

The multitude of coffee makers available today may seem daunting. However, significant consideration should be given to the type of coffee bean being used and desired flavor. Different coffee makers can yield different results:

  • Drip Coffee Makers: Best for classic brews, compatible with medium roasts.
  • Espresso Machines: Ideal for short, rich shots; best paired with dark roasts.
  • French Press: Works well with coarsely ground beans, great for full-bodied flavors.

When acquiring a coffee maker, reflect on personal preferences regarding strength, flavor, and convenience to ensure it aligns with lifestyle habits. Investing in quality equipment can significantly improve the overall coffee experience.

Types of Coffee Beans

Arabica

Arabica is the most popular type of coffee bean globally. Its key characteristic is a sweet, soft taste with hints of fruit and sugar. Arabica beans are beneficial because they generally have a higher acidity than other types of beans, creating a complex flavor. One unique feature is their requirement for specific growing conditions, typically found in high altitudes with cooler temperatures. Arabica’s advantages include a wide variety of flavor profiles, though they tend to be more susceptible to pests and diseases.

Robusta

Robusta beans are another significant type, known for their strong, bold flavor and higher caffeine content. This makes Robusta a popular choice for coffee blends, particularly for espresso due to its crema-enhancing properties. The key feature of Robusta is its resilience; it can grow in lower altitudes and harsher climates. Despite its bitterness being a potential downside, many enjoy the strong body and earthy flavors Robusta offers.

Liberica

Liberica beans have a distinctive shape and flavor profile that sets them apart from other beans. These beans are often described as having a floral and fruity taste, with some likening it to wood or spices. Its contribution to this article is essential, as it showcases diversity in flavors that can be achieved with different beans. However, Liberica beans are less common, making them a specialty choice for those seeking unique tastes.

Excelsa

Excelsa beans are interesting due to their unique flavor, often described as fruity or tart, adding depth to blends. They are a rare choice and mainly used to accentuate flavor profiles in blends rather than as a standalone bean. Unlike Arabica and Robusta, Excelsa beans thrive in certain conditions that are not always met in global coffee production. Therefore, while they can enhance coffee's complexity, their availability can be limited.

Growing Conditions

Climate

Climate plays a crucial role in the cultivation of coffee beans. It is characterized by the need for specific temperature ranges and consistent rainfall. For coffee growers, ideal climate conditions result in beans with optimal flavor profiles. However, climate change poses a significant risk to coffee production, potentially disrupting established growing areas.

Soil

Soil quality is equally important for coffee growth. It needs to be rich in organic matter, well-drained, and balanced in pH. The type of soil can significantly affect the nutrient absorption of the coffee plant, which in turn influences the taste of the coffee. Certain soils can enhance sweetness or acidity in the finished product, making soil a critical consideration.

Altitude

Altitude greatly influences the maturity and flavor development of coffee beans. Generally, beans grown at higher altitudes develop more complex flavors due to slower growth. The cooler temperatures slow the bean ripening process, contributing to enhanced acidity and flavor richness. However, growing coffee at higher altitudes can also present a challenge due to the risks of frost and lower yields.

Processing Methods

Washed

The washed process involves removing the cherry fruit surrounding the bean before it is fermented. This method produces a cleaner flavor profile, highlighting the coffee's acidity. It is a popular method for high-quality Arabica coffees. However, the washed process requires a significant amount of water, which can be a limiting factor in drought-prone areas.

Natural

Natural processing allows the beans to dry inside the fruit. This results in a more fruity flavor and a heavier body. It is a less resource-intensive method compared to washed processing. However, it can lead to uneven flavors if not monitored correctly.

Honey

Honey processing is a hybrid method that partially removes the fruit before drying. This allows some of the sugar content to influence the flavor. The advantage of honey processing lies in its ability to produce a sweet, complex cup without the high water requirement of the washed method. However, it requires careful management to avoid fermentation issues.

Flavor Profiles

Tasting Notes

Tasting notes refer to the specific flavors present in coffee. These notes can range from fruity to nutty, each associated with particular beans and processing methods. Understanding these notes enhances the overall appreciation of coffee and informs selection based on personal taste preferences.

Acidity

Acidity in coffee can significantly affect the drinking experience. It is characterized by bright and crisp flavors that cleanse the palate. High acidity often indicates high-quality beans, but too much can overpower the other flavor attributes. Therefore, a balanced acidity is desirable.

Body

The body of coffee refers to its weight or thickness on the palate. Typically measured by its mouthfeel, a full-bodied coffee will have a rich and thick profile, while a light-bodied coffee feels more delicate. Body is often influenced by the bean type and processing method, playing a significant role in overall enjoyment.

Types of Coffee Makers

Drip Coffee Makers

Drip coffee makers are one of the most common brewing devices. They work by dripping hot water over coffee grounds contained in a filter. This method is straightforward, making it accessible for newcomers. The convenience of loading the machine and setting a timer makes it a very popular choice among busy individuals.
A unique feature of drip coffee makers is their ability to produce multiple cups at once, making it ideal for gatherings. However, they may lack the depth of flavor that other methods can provide, which proves a drawback for aficionados.

French Press

The French press offers a different experience in brewing. It allows the coffee grounds to steep in hot water before pressing down a filter. This method accentuates the oils and flavors of the coffee, giving it a robust profile that many prefer. A key characteristic of the French press is its simplicity and the full control it provides over brewing time and water temperature, making it a favorite among enthusiasts. Despite its advantages, it can be messy and requires more physical effort compared to automatic machines.

Espresso Machines

Espresso machines are designed to create rich, concentrated shots of coffee through high-pressure brewing. They are integral for espresso-based drinks like lattes and cappuccinos. The technical nature of these machines serves as a draw for serious coffee drinkers, aiming to achieve cafΓ©-quality beverages at home. One unique aspect is the ability to control various parameters such as pressure and temperature, which influences flavor. However, the complexity and price of high-quality machines can deter casual brewers.

Aeropress

The Aeropress is known for its portability and quick brewing capabilities. It uses air pressure to push hot water through coffee, resulting in a smooth, concentrated brew. Ideal for travel or quick coffee fixes, it supports various grind sizes and offers flexibility in brewing style. A significant advantage is that it’s easy to clean and does not take up much space. However, it typically produces a single serving, which might not satisfy those brewing for multiple people.

Pour Over

Pour over coffee makers allow for precise control over the brewing process, emphasizing the art of coffee making. This method involves pouring hot water directly over coffee grounds in a filter. This technique can highlight individual flavor notes of the coffee used. The key characteristic is the skill required β€” the timing and pouring technique greatly impact the result. While pour over can be rewarding, it does require patience and practice, which may not suit everyone.

Grinding Coffee Beans

Grind Size

The grind size directly correlates with the brewing method. A coarse grind is essential for methods like the French Press, as it allows for optimal extraction without over-extracting the bitter compounds. Conversely, a fine grind is preferable for espresso, where quick extraction is crucial.

The unique feature of grind size lies in its ability to dictate how water interacts with coffee. If the grind is too fine, it can lead to bitterness; too coarse, and it may produce a weak flavor. Achieving the right balance is beneficial for enhancing the taste profile.

Impact on Flavor

The impact on flavor stems from how the extraction process unfolds during brewing. Different grind sizes affect the surface area exposed to water, influencing the amount of oils and flavors that surface in the cup. A well-ground coffee is more aromatic and flavorful than poorly ground beans.

Variability in grind size leads to a range of flavor profiles, making it a critical consideration in any brewing scenario. This characteristic helps highlight the complexity and richness of the coffee beans being used.

Grinding Methods

Grinding methods vary from blade grinders to burr grinders. Burr grinders are more favored because they produce a more uniform grind compared to blade grinders, which can lead to inconsistency. Conversely, blade grinders may be more accessible but often result in uneven particle sizes.

The benefit of using burr grinders lies in their capability to maintain the integrity of flavor profiles, allowing for a better extraction process.

Measuring Coffee and Water

Standard Ratios

Standard ratios, typically one to two tablespoons of coffee per six ounces of water, provide a foundational guideline for brewing. This measurement helps maintain balance in flavor intensity and overall satisfaction in the final cup.

When brewing, following these standard ratios ensures consistency and quality in each batch made, proving essential for anyone serious about their coffee experience.

Personal Preference

Personal preference plays a substantial role in how one measures coffee and water. While guidelines provide structure, individual palate adjustments will refine the taste. For example, some may prefer a stronger brew and adjust their coffee-to-water ratio accordingly.

In this regard, personal preference allows for experimentation, enhancing the crafting process of one's unique brew.

Using Scales

Using scales to measure coffee and water ensures precision. This practice eliminates ambiguity and fosters repeatable results. Digital scales allow precise measurement in grams, which can drastically improve brewing consistency.

It eliminates guesswork and aids in achieving an accurate extraction.

Water Quality and Temperature

Filtered vs. Tap Water

Choosing between filtered and tap water can significantly impact flavor. Filtered water often contains fewer impurities and higher mineral balance, making it a better choice for brewing. Tap water, depending on the source, can include various chemicals that may alter taste adversely.

The unique feature of filtered water is its ability to foster a clean and crisp coffee flavor.

Optimal Brewing Temperature

The optimal brewing temperature typically falls between 195Β°F and 205Β°F. Water within this range extracts flavors effectively, while water that is too hot or too cool may lead to improper extraction.

Maintaining this temperature range is beneficial for producing a well-rounded cup of coffee.

Effects on Extraction

Different water temperatures influence extraction rates. Too hot water can extract unwanted bitter compounds, while cold water may under-extract, leaving the coffee devoid of depth. Understanding the effects on extraction underscores the importance of water temperature in achieving the desired coffee profile.

Brewing Techniques for Different Makers

Drip Method

The drip method is one of the most common brewing techniques. It allows water to flow through coffee grounds within a filter, yielding a clean and well-balanced cup. The key characteristic here is convenience and consistency, making it a popular choice for home brewing.

The unique feature of the drip method lies in its ability to serve multiple cups at once, positioning it as a favored choice for gatherings.

French Press Technique

The French Press technique requires immersion of coffee grounds in hot water, followed by manual separation using a plunger. This method highlights oils in coffee, promoting a fuller flavor. The key characteristic is its simplicity and richness in taste.

However, this technique does require more effort and careful timing to avoid bitterness due to over-extraction.

Espresso Extraction

Espresso extraction relies on forcing hot water through finely-ground coffee, resulting in a concentrated brew. This method is unique because it develops a bold profile and rich crema, setting it apart from other brewing techniques.

The key characteristic of espresso lies in its intensity and complexity, delivering a distinct flavor in a small volume.

Storing coffee beans properly is essential for any coffee enthusiast. The storage conditions can significantly impact the flavor and quality of the coffee. This section will discuss the optimal storage conditions that will help maintain freshness and the best containers for storing coffee beans effectively.

Optimal Storage Conditions

Air Exposure

Air exposure can quickly degrade coffee beans. When beans are exposed to oxygen, oxidation occurs, leading to stale flavor over time. This makes limiting air exposure crucial for preserving flavor. An essential characteristic of air exposure is the speed at which it affects the coffee. Being a natural oxidizing agent, air can alter volatile compounds that contribute to aroma and taste. Few things can ruin a good cup of coffee faster than improper storage.

To reduce air exposure, it is often recommended to use storage methods that minimize the open air contact with beans. A downside is the knowledge that once a package is open, degradation begins, making it a race against time. Thus, the attention to detail in storage choice is critical.

Temperature Control

Temperature control greatly affects the longevity of coffee beans. Ideally, beans should be stored at a consistent, cool temperature. Fluctuations can result in condensation, which can introduce moisture to the beans, promoting spoilage. A key characteristic is that high temperatures accelerate the loss of flavor. Understanding the thermodynamics of coffee storage means storing them away from heat sources.

One advantage to controlling temperature is prolonging the freshness, thus ensuring that the coffee stays aromatic. Heat can cause oils in the beans to become rancid much faster. However, not all storage devices provide the temperature stability needed.

Humidity Levels

Humidity levels play a crucial role in coffee storage as well. High humidity can lead to mold growth, whereas low humidity can dry out the beans, both scenarios impacting flavor negatively. The ideal humidity for coffee storage is around 60-70%. A notable characteristic of humidity is its ability to affect the texture and consistency of the beans. Balancing humidity levels can enhance the preservation effectively.

Proper humidity control ensures that the essential oils within the beans are kept intact. However, achieving the right humidity often requires a dedicated space or particular containers that are less accessible for many.

Best Containers for Storage

Choosing the right container is significant for sealing in flavor and freshness. Several options prove beneficial for coffee storage.

Airtight Jars

Airtight jars are a popular choice because they effectively limit air exposure. The primary advantage is their ability to create a sealed environment that keeps coffee fresh for an extended period. A unique feature of these jars is usually made from glass or high-quality plastic. However, they must be stored in a cool, dark place to maximize their effectiveness.

A relative disadvantage includes the risk of breaking the jar, which can be problematic if not handled with care.

Vacuum Seal Bags

Vacuum seal bags provide a practical option as they remove air entirely from the storage space. This unique feature prevents oxidation efficiently, resulting in longer-lasting freshness. These bags are also lightweight and take up less space.

A potential downside is that vacuum sealing can require equipment and some know-how to use effectively. If not sealed correctly, they might not deliver the desired results.

Opaque Containers

Opaque containers protect coffee beans from light, which is another detrimental factor for freshness. The key characteristic is their ability to block light, thus avoiding photo-oxidation. Using these containers can help prolong the freshness of coffee, especially when kept in a stable temperature environment.

However, the downside is that they must also be airtight to prevent humidity and air from sneaking in. Finding a container that offers both features may take additional time and effort.

Global Coffee Traditions

Italian Espresso Culture

Italian espresso culture stands out for its precision and ritual surrounding coffee consumption. The espresso is not just a drink but an experience that encompasses the art of brewing and the joy of socializing. One key characteristic of this culture is the focus on quality, with strong emphasis on the perfect shot of espresso. The espresso's rich flavor and crema contribute to its status as a beloved choice for coffee drinkers.

A unique feature of Italian espresso coffee is the practice of enjoying it quickly, often while standing at the bar. This approach allows for a more communal feel, fostering interactions among patrons. The advantages of this tradition include a quick boost of caffeine, yet it may not suit those who prefer leisurely sipping.

Turkish Coffee Customs

Turkish coffee customs present a distinct method of preparation that has been passed down through generations. The coffee is brewed using finely ground beans, water, and often sugar, in a special pot called a cezve. A notable aspect of this method is the slow brewing process, allowing the flavors to deepen as the coffee is heated.

The key characteristic of Turkish coffee is its strong flavor and thick texture due to the unfiltered grounds. This makes it an interesting choice for those who seek a robust experience. The ritual of serving Turkish coffee often includes a glass of water and sometimes a sweet treat, enhancing the overall experience. However, the sediment at the bottom might be a downside for some drinkers.

Latin American Coffee Ceremonies

Latin American coffee ceremonies are rich in tradition and social significance. In various cultures, coffee serves as a medium for hospitality and bonding. The preparation often involves an intricate process, which may include roasting beans at home to achieve a personal touch. A prime characteristic here is the focus on community, as coffee is regularly enjoyed in groups, fostering conversation.

The unique feature of these ceremonies is how they blend coffee with local customs, such as traditional songs or stories during serving, which enhances the communal spirit. While this tradition is broadly appreciated, it might not appeal to those seeking a quick coffee fix.

Trends in Coffee Consumption

Specialty Coffee Movement

The specialty coffee movement has gained momentum over recent years, emphasizing quality and unique flavors. This uprising highlights the pursuit of excellence, leading to a more informed consumer base. The key characteristic is a focus on direct trade and sourcing beans from specific farms known for their unique flavor profiles.

This movement's unique feature is the commitment to transparency in the production process, making it a beneficial choice for those who value ethical practices. However, the prices for specialty coffee can be higher, which may not be suitable for all budgets.

Sustainability in Coffee

Sustainability in coffee has become a pressing concern for consumers and producers alike. As climate change affects coffee growing regions, an increasing number of coffee brands aim to adopt sustainable practices. One key characteristic of this trend is the emphasis on organic farming methods and biodiversity.

The unique feature of this focus is the dual benefit of protecting the environment while ensuring quality beans. However, the transition to sustainable practices can sometimes increase costs, impacting pricing for consumers.

Health Benefits and Practices

The health benefits associated with coffee consumption are widely recognized. Studies have indicated that moderate coffee intake may lower the risk of certain diseases, such as Parkinson's and type 2 diabetes. The key characteristic of this aspect is a growing awareness of the positives linked to coffee.

Highlighting the unique features of different brewing methods can also contribute to enhanced health benefits. For instance, methods like cold brew may have lower acidity compared to traditional brewing, potentially making it gentler on the stomach. However, excessive consumption can lead to negative effects, and balancing intake remains important.
